This book is primarily an introduction to the vast family of ceramic materials. The first part is devoted to the basics of ceramics and processes: raw materials, powders synthesis, shaping and sintering. It discusses traditional ceramics as well as 'technical' ceramics - oxide and non-oxide - which have multiple developments. The second part focuses on properties and applications. The book discusses both structural and functional ceramics, including bioceramics. The fields of abrasion, cutting, and tribology illustrate the importance of mechanical properties.
